Is there a lot of diversity? Are people in Pasay City accepting of differences?
When we asked people about diversity in Pasay City and whether locals are accepting of differences, they said...
"Pasay City is a diverse city with a variety of ethnicities, religions, and cultures. People in Pasay City are generally accepting of differences and are welcoming to people from all backgrounds. The city is known for its vibrant culture and its people are known for their hospitality and openness to different cultures," said a member in Pasay City, Philippines.
